A major UK construction contractor is seeking an experienced Project Controls Engineer to join its delivery team on HPC on a long term temporary basis. This role offers the opportunity to support one of the country's most complex engineering projects, working across planning, scheduling, cost control, progress measurement and performance reporting. You will play a key role in ensuring schedule and cost integrity across multiple work packages, contractors and technical interfaces, helping to maintain robust governance and high-quality project reporting.

The Role

  • Planning & Scheduling
    • Developing and maintaining integrated master schedules (IMS) using Primavera P6.
    • Managing baseline schedules, WBS structures and coding aligned to client requirements.
    • Conducting critical path analysis, float management and schedule risk analysis.
    • Reviewing contractor and subcontractor schedules for compliance.
  • Cost Control & Commercial Support
    • Analysing delays and supporting Extension of Time (EOT) and claims assessments.
    • Assisting with budget development, cost plans and cash-flow forecasting.
    • Monitoring cost performance against budgets and funding limits.
    • Tracking variations, compensation events and change orders.
    • Supporting earned value management (EVM) and performance indices.
  • Progress Measurement & Reporting
    • Establishing progress measurement systems aligned with contract milestones.
    • Monitoring physical progress, productivity and installed quantities.
    • Producing weekly, monthly and executive-level status reports.
    • Developing dashboards and KPIs across schedule, cost and risk.
  • Risk, Interface & Change Management
    • Supporting schedule and cost risk identification and mitigation.
    • Assessing impacts of design changes, utilities, land constraints and third-party interfaces.
    • Maintaining change logs and supporting impact assessments.
  • Stakeholder Coordination & Governance
    • Coordinating with consultants, contractors, client teams and authorities.
    • Ensuring compliance with project controls procedures and governance requirements.
    • Participating in progress meetings, risk workshops and reviews.

About You

You will ideally have:

  • Strong experience in project controls or project management on large, complex infrastructure or construction projects.
  • A degree in Engineering, Construction Management or a related discipline.
  • Strong communication skills and experience leading or supporting technical teams.
  • Proficiency in Primavera P6, EVM processes, and advanced Excel.
  • Experience with NEC-based major infrastructure projects (desirable).
  • Experience with reporting tools such as Power BI or Primavera Analytics (preferred).
  • Strong analytical skills, stakeholder management capability and attention to detail.
  • Working towards professional chartership (e.g., RICS/CICES) is advantageous.
